Course content
Anatomy and physiology of the auditory analyzer, basic hearing disorders and their treatment options. Symptomatology, diagnostics, and treatment of inflammation of the ear, nose, paranasal sinuses, the pharynx, and their complications. Symptomatology, diagnostics, and fundamentals of treatment of malignant tumours in ENT. Dyspnoea and causes of dyspnoea due to an occlusion of upper respiratory pathways. The patient after a tracheostomy and laryngectomy. Care of the tracheal cannula, suction from the respiratory pathways. Traumatology in ENT. Epistaxis. Introduction, notes on anatomy and physiology of the visual analyzer, basic disorders. External and internal eye inflammation. Cataract, glaucoma, eye injury. Ophthalmosurgery. Introduction, anatomy, tooth topography. Fundamentals of preservation stomatology. Stomatological surgery. Fundamentals of prosthetic stomatology. Tooth decay prevention. Anatomy and physiology of the skin. Classification of skin diseases. Skin diseases due to external causes. Care of the complexion. Dermatomycoses, allergic illnesses. Photobiology. Veneral diseases.

Learning outcomes
The aim of the course is to acquaint students with fundamental examination methods, nursing care, and first aid in urgent conditions in otorhinolaryngology, with care of the tracheostomised patient and with symptoms of inflammatory and oncological illnesses in the ENT area. With refractory defects, eye cataracts, inflammatory diseases of the eye, eye injury issues, and fundamentals of social issues associated with poor vision and blindness. With diagnostics and prevention of tooth illnesses and illnesses of oral cavity tissues. Furthermore, fundamentals of preservation, surgical, prosthetic, and child stomatology are explained, including orthodontics and parodontology. With fundamental groups of skin diseases and possibilities of their transmission, treatment, and prevention. An independent part is devoted to sexually transmitted diseases including reporting and detection.
The student gains a basic overview of the fields of otorhinolaryngology, dermatovenerology, ophthalmology, and stomatology.
